Chapter 1388: Who Do You Think You Are?

Yang Haoran's Death God uniform, in some respects, truly symbolized Yang Haoran himself, for it bore his personal information. This was true not just for a Guardian's Death God uniform, but even an Emissary of Death's uniform, which similarly contained detailed information.

Under normal circumstances, an Underworld Official would never hand over their Death God uniform to another, as it represented their identity, and doing so carelessly could easily lead to trouble. However, in special situations, the Death God uniform could indeed be given to someone else as a token of trust.

Yang Haoran trusted Old Master Wu's authority in the Ninth District and believed his other trusted subordinates would cooperate with Old Master Wu. Nevertheless, for the sake of security and to prevent any unforeseen incidents, he still took off his Death God uniform and handed it to Old Master Wu. With his uniform, everything would be foolproof. As long as there were no traitors like Xiao Kang, there would certainly be no one disobeying orders, at least not in the short term.

"As you command!"

The situation was urgent, and Old Master Wu understood the stakes involved. Thus, he didn't hesitate for a moment. There was no emotional speech, no melodramatic parting, nor any probing questions. He knew time waited for no one, and the enemy certainly wouldn't grant him time for idle chatter. So, after catching the Death God uniform Yang Haoran tossed to him, he simply responded with two words, and with a flash of his body, he charged towards the staircase.

Though his two-word reply was brief and crisp, it carried an immense weight, like a thousand pounds!

"Think you can leave? I don't think so!"

The slightly corpulent man scoffed, speaking with a cold sneer, while his hands moved with no less speed. With a flick of his wrist, chains condensed into a massive net, completely blocking Old Master Wu's path!

The suddenness of the situation left the slightly corpulent man no time to form hand seals and unleash a Ghost Art. However, he didn't believe Old Master Wu would be his match. In his view, for him, a Guardian, to capture Old Master Wu, a mere ghost, would be an effortless task. Moreover, the power of an Underworld Official inherently possessed a strong suppressive effect on ghosts, making it even easier to subdue Old Master Wu. Why bother with Ghost Arts? A regular attack would be more than enough to stop Old Master Wu.

The space on the second floor wasn't large to begin with, but the suddenly appearing net was considerable, occupying a significant portion of it. Because of this, the net of chains didn't just seal off the staircase; it also cordoned off the entire area around the staircase.

"Heh, does my turf need your permission? Who do you think you are?"

Yang Haoran let out a cold snort. While his words were directed at the slightly corpulent man, he himself charged towards the middle-aged woman who was preparing to strike.

As he spoke, powerful Spirit Power whistled from Yang Haoran's hands, interrupting the middle-aged woman's hand seals. While the slightly corpulent man was condensing his chains, this middle-aged woman hadn't been idle; she was forming hand seals to unleash a Ghost Art. Yang Haoran saw this unfold, and naturally, he wouldn't allow her to successfully cast her Ghost Art.

While Yang Haoran acted to interrupt the middle-aged woman's Ghost Art, he simultaneously multitasked, releasing a massive amount of Spirit Power from his body to forcibly shatter the large net of chains condensed by the slightly corpulent man.

Old Master Wu, who had originally intended to break through the net of chains himself, saw Yang Haoran shatter them in a mere instant. He didn't foolishly stand there in shock; instead, he seized this chance and rushed out of the second floor in one breath. This was an unmissable opportunity. If he didn't seize it to leave immediately, then once these two Guardians from the Tong Continent Yin Division got serious, his escape would undoubtedly become far more troublesome, and he would certainly add a greater burden to Yang Haoran.

All of this happened in an instant. While the slightly corpulent man and the middle-aged woman were still reeling from Yang Haoran's display of power, Old Master Wu had already surged out of the second floor, vanishing without a trace. It was too late for them to intervene and stop him now!

"Damn it! He actually got away! I'll go after him! Yang Haoran is yours to deal with!"

The slightly corpulent man swore loudly, and without waiting for the middle-aged woman's reply, he prepared to rush out of the second floor to pursue Old Master Wu.

"Neither of you are going anywhere!"

Yang Haoran spoke coolly. Just as he finished speaking, the slightly corpulent man had already charged forward.

Bang! !

A light barrier materialized at the staircase entrance, sealing it off. The slightly corpulent man collided squarely with this barrier. Before he charged out, the light barrier had been in a concealed state, only revealing itself as he crashed into it; it was a light barrier formed by a restraint barrier.

This restraint barrier was precisely the one Yang Haoran had activated and then caused to vanish when he first entered the second floor. After successfully reaching the second floor, he hadn't immediately reactivated it because he wanted to ensure Old Master Wu could pass through unhindered, without needing to open the barrier again.

After Old Master Wu rushed out of the second floor, Yang Haoran immediately and silently reactivated the restraint barrier on the second floor. The slightly corpulent man and the middle-aged woman weren't paying attention to it; their focus was entirely on Old Master Wu and Yang Haoran. Furthermore, the restraint barrier had been activated stealthily, so the two hadn't noticed, leading to the current scene.

Given the slightly corpulent man's strength, any ordinary restraint barrier would have surely been torn open by such a collision, failing to obstruct him in the slightest. Yet, the light barrier formed by this particular restraint barrier not only blocked him but even repelled him, demonstrating its extraordinary nature.

The slightly corpulent man stabilized himself, a look of shock on his face. Yang Haoran's displayed power had already taken him by surprise, but the fact that he couldn't break through this restraint barrier, and was even repelled by it, astonished him even further.

The slightly corpulent man wasn't the only one shocked; the middle-aged woman was equally astonished. However, Yang Haoran didn't pause because of their surprise. A torrent of Spirit Power surged from his body, and under his control, launched a fierce assault on both of them, catching them completely off guard!

Inside Yang Haoran's study, the Tongzhou Great Emperor sat in Yang Haoran's chair, his legs crossed and his brows slightly furrowed.

"What are those two up to?"

The Tongzhou Great Emperor muttered to himself. The "two rascals" he spoke of were none other than the slightly corpulent man and the middle-aged woman.

The reason for his furrowed brow was that when Yang Haoran and the two had first left the study, he had been able to sense their presence through the faint power fluctuations emanating from them. Not only them, but he could also sense the faint power fluctuations from Yang Haoran.

However, this situation only lasted for a short while. Before long, he could no longer sense the power fluctuations from the two Guardians, nor from Yang Haoran.

When this first occurred, he hadn't been concerned. This was because not only did the slightly corpulent man and the middle-aged woman have confidence in their own abilities, but he too had confidence in his two subordinates' strength. He didn't believe Yang Haoran would be a match for them. After all, Yang Haoran had become a Guardian too recently; his power couldn't be that formidable. In his estimation, looking at the entire Guardian cohort, Yang Haoran's strength was definitely among the lowest tier.

In contrast, the two Guardians he had brought with him were entirely different from Yang Haoran. Both were veteran Guardians; within the Guardian cohort, if not among the very top, they were certainly upper-middle tier. For them to deal with Yang Haoran, this newcomer, would be an effortless task. Even if this was Yang Haoran's Guardian District, it would be no exception. Thus, when he couldn't sense their power fluctuations, he wasn't worried at all.

But as of now, their power fluctuations had been gone for quite some time. What had initially caused him no concern had now sparked a flicker of doubt in his mind; he couldn't fathom what the two were doing.

After a brief moment of thought, a guess formed in the Tongzhou Great Emperor's mind.

"Could it be that they've set up a restraint barrier to trap Yang Haoran, and now they're taking this opportunity to give him a good lesson?"

The Tongzhou Great Emperor formed this guess because he had a certain understanding of the personalities of his two subordinate Guardians. He felt that his two subordinates might very well do this. After all, the Tong Continent Yin Division and the Jingling Continent Yin Division had considerable grievances between them, and the same was true among their Guardians. Since there was an opportunity to teach a lesson to a Guardian from the opposing side, they naturally wouldn't want to easily miss it.

At this thought, the Tongzhou Great Emperor's slightly furrowed brow relaxed.

"Never mind. If they want to play around, let them play. As long as it doesn't delay things too long, letting off some steam on Yang Haoran, a Guardian from the opposing side, isn't such a bad thing."
